wangle

[US]/'wæŋg(ə)l/
[UK]/'wæŋgl/
Frequency: Very High

Translation

n. 欺詐行爲;哄騙;僞造
vt. 扭身擠出;使用詭計;騙取
vi. 設法脫身;用詭計獲得
Word Forms
過去式wangled
過去分詞wangled
現在分詞wangling
第三人稱單數wangles
複數wangles

Phrases & Collocations

wangle a deal

巧妙地達成交易

wangle an invitation

巧取豪取邀請

Example Sentences

to wangle an invitation to a party

用詐騙手段得到 一張參加集會的請柬

She wangled an invitation.

她設法弄到了一張請柬。

I wangled an invitation to her flat.

我設法使她邀請我去她的公寓。

wangled a job for which she had no training.

騙取了一個她根本沒有受過有關方面訓練的工作

I wangled George into a good job.

我設法替喬治弄到一份好工作。

I think we should be able to wangle it so that you can start tomorrow.

我想我們應該能夠想辦法讓你明天可以出發。
